S.T.A.L.K.E.R. 2: Heart of Chornobyl emerges as gearing up for a significant expansion that will be available starting tomorrow. Fans of the game can expect a comprehensive free content update that significantly enriches the gameplay experience.
A representative from the development team announced that the new downloadable content, titled Stories Untold, will launch on 16 December without any additional charge. This free update brings with it a plethora of fresh material designed to engage players for many hours.
The update introduces several notable additions, including:
- A fresh series of eight quests meant to occupy players for a considerable amount of time.
- Seven detailed new areas waiting to be discovered and thoroughly explored.
- Six distinct new characters, each accompanied by their own narrative and background.
- An exclusive new weapon available for those willing to seek it out.
- A new central area located in the Burnt Forest, complete with essential operatives such as a Medic, Technician, Trader, and Guide.
For those who have yet to Embark on an immersive journey through S.T.A.L.K.E.R. 2: Heart of Chornobyl, the title has been accessible on Xbox and PC for some time, with PlayStation 5 support having been added earlier this year.
